Photos of the moon
I've recently taken videos of the moon & stacked them to make photos but I cannot fit the whole moon in. Do I need to get a focal reducer or use a smaller telescope?

Re: Photos of the moon
Hi Chris,
It is the dobsonian (Diameter 200mm, Focal Length 1200mm f5.9)
The camera is a ZWO ASI034MC

Re: Photos of the moon
The first thing you should check is the capture area setting for the camera.For the largest possible field of view set the pixel count to the highest available(I think your asi camera is 728x512 pixels) If you still cant get the whole moon in make sure your camera is as close to the focuser as possible (no spacer tubes,barlows or adaptors etc.) A focal reducer should help but I would see what you can achieve with the Asi fish eye lens that might have been supplied with the camera.Hope any of this helps.
